6 FAQs about [Microgrid Risk Assessment]

What is a microgrid risk assessment?

Assessing risk to a microgrid essentially means finding a way to quantify the relative potential of damage that various threats in the environment can cause. Risk is a function of threats exploiting vulnerabilities to impact the operations and damage or destroy the assets.

How is risk created in a microgrid?

Risk is created when a threat can exploit an already present vulnerability in the microgrid. The magnitude of the risk is determined by the likelihood of the threat and the vulnerability, as well as the scale of damage the vulnerability could cause if exploited.

What is risk analysis for Microgrid deployment?

The process of risk analysis for Microgrid deployment involves first analyzing the business risks associated with economic operations. Next, the risks associated with the microgrid's resilience are identified and quantified.

Should microgrids rely on a single energy source?

For microgrids located on islands, diversification of generation resources with renewable energy can decrease the cost of operation. This is due to the high cost and risk associated with transporting generator fuel over long distances.

What physical threats do microgrids face?

Microgrids are typically vulnerable to physical threats such as natural hazards and changing climate, as well as human-induced attacks. Natural hazards and a changing climate pose physical threats to microgrids.
